My question is how do I update the adapter and sound driver?
 
You appear to have onboard video graphics and audio built into the motherboard, with only 256 mb of memory. This means you may need to add a video graphics card, and additional memory. Your board may be limited to 512 MB, and a fairly ancient video graphics socket.
So please tell us more about your computer... brand and model, or the numbers off the center of the motherboard. The 82810E could relate to a large variety of boards, so we need to know more.
